A contractor or engineer who aspires to win a contract with the DOD must abide by the rules. A lack of safety practices and knowledge of keeping the workers safe on the site can prove to be hazardous in the long run. This makes it imperative to go through the “Manual EM 385-1-1” published by the “U.S. Army Corps of Engineers' Safety and Health Requirements.” Ignoring the dos and don’ts can also put the contractor and/or supervisor in trouble. The manager in charge may report the noncompliance as violating the regulations and revoke the contract for good. Besides, one may be penalized heavily for it too. Sure, one may correct the lapses and gain the contract once again. The best way forward in such circumstances is to undergo the EM 385 40 hour online that is similar to OSHA courses but not identical.
